Understanding LED THT EOLD-810-095-4
The EOLD-810-095-4 operates at a peak wavelength of 810 nm, placing it in the near-infrared region commonly used for sensing and detection applications. It delivers approximately 10 mW optical output at a typical operating current of 100 mA, ensuring strong and stable performance.
Unlike narrow-beam LEDs, this model features a wide viewing angle (~90°–180°) due to its flat window design, enabling uniform illumination over larger areas.
Its hermetic TO-46 package ensures excellent thermal stability and environmental protection, making it suitable for continuous operation in demanding industrial and scientific environments.
Technical Specifications
| Parameter | Specification |
| Product | EOLD-810-095-4 |
| Type | NIR Infrared LED |
| Peak Wavelength | 810 nm |
| Optical Output Power | ~10 mW |
| Radiant Intensity | ~8 mW/sr |
| Forward Current | ~100 mA |
| Forward Voltage | ~1.6 V |
| Spectral Width (FWHM) | ~35 nm |
| Viewing Angle | ~90° – 180° |
| Package | TO-46 Metal Can (Flat Window) |
| Mounting Type | Through-hole |
| Operating Temperature | -40°C to +105°C |
| Compliance | RoHS compliant |
